363 }
364
365 /****************************************************************************
366  * int hdac_reset(hdac_softc *, int)
367  *
368  * Reset the hdac to a quiescent and known state.
369  ****************************************************************************/
370 static int
371 hdac_reset(struct hdac_softc *sc, int wakeup)
372 {
373         uint32_t gctl;
374         int count, i;
375
376         /*
377          * Stop all Streams DMA engine
378          */
379         for (i = 0; i < sc->num_iss; i++)
380                 H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_ISDCTL(sc, i), 0x0);
381         for (i = 0; i < sc->num_oss; i++)
382                 H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_OSDCTL(sc, i), 0x0);
383         for (i = 0; i < sc->num_bss; i++)
384                 H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_BSDCTL(sc, i), 0x0);
385
386         /*
387          * Stop Control DMA engines.
388          */
389         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BCTL, 0x0);
390         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BCTL, 0x0);
391
392         /*
393          * Reset DMA position buffer.
394          */
395         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_DPIBLBASE, 0x0);
396         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_DPIBUBASE, 0x0);
397
398         /*
399          * Reset the controller. The reset must remain asserted for
400          * a minimum of 100us.
401          */
402         gctl = HDAC_READ_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_GCTL);
403         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_GCTL, gctl & ~HDAC_GCTL_CRST);
404         count = 10000;
405         do {
406                 gctl = HDAC_READ_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_GCTL);
407                 if (!(gctl & HDAC_GCTL_CRST))
408                         break;
409                 DELAY(10);
410         } while (--count);
411         if (gctl & HDAC_GCTL_CRST) {
412                 device_printf(sc->dev, "Unable to put hdac in reset\n");
413                 return (ENXIO);
414         }
415
416         /* If wakeup is not requested - leave the controller in reset state. */
417         if (!wakeup)
418                 return (0);
419
420         DELAY(100);
421         gctl = HDAC_READ_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_GCTL);
422         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_GCTL, gctl | HDAC_GCTL_CRST);
423         count = 10000;
424         do {
425                 gctl = HDAC_READ_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_GCTL);
426                 if (gctl & HDAC_GCTL_CRST)
427                         break;
428                 DELAY(10);
429         } while (--count);
430         if (!(gctl & HDAC_GCTL_CRST)) {
431                 device_printf(sc->dev, "Device stuck in reset\n");
432                 return (ENXIO);
433         }
434
435         /*
436          * Wait for codecs to finish their own reset sequence. The delay here
437          * should be of 250us but for some reasons, it's not enough on my
438          * computer. Let's use twice as much as necessary to make sure that
439          * it's reset properly.
440          */
441         DELAY(1000);
442
443         return (0);
444 }

755 }
756
757 /****************************************************************************
758  * void hdac_corb_init(struct hdac_softc *)
759  *
760  * Initialize the corb registers for operations but do not start it up yet.
761  * The CORB engine must not be running when this function is called.
762  ****************************************************************************/
763 static void
764 hdac_corb_init(struct hdac_softc *sc)
765 {
766         uint8_t corbsize;
767         uint64_t corbpaddr;
768
769         /* Setup the CORB size. */
770         switch (sc->corb_size) {
771         case 256:
772                 corbsize = HDAC_CORBSIZE_CORBSIZE(HDAC_CORBSIZE_CORBSIZE_256);
773                 break;
774         case 16:
775                 corbsize = HDAC_CORBSIZE_CORBSIZE(HDAC_CORBSIZE_CORBSIZE_16);
776                 break;
777         case 2:
778                 corbsize = HDAC_CORBSIZE_CORBSIZE(HDAC_CORBSIZE_CORBSIZE_2);
779                 break;
780         default:
781                 panic("%s: Invalid CORB size (%x)\n", __func__, sc->corb_size);
782         }
783         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BSIZE, corbsize);
784
785         /* Setup the CORB Address in the hdac */
786         corbpaddr = (uint64_t)sc->corb_dma.dma_paddr;
787         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BLBASE, (uint32_t)corbpaddr);
788         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BUBASE, (uint32_t)(corbpaddr >> 32));
789
790         /* Set the WP and RP */
791         sc->corb_wp = 0;
792         HDAC_WRITE_2(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BWP, sc->corb_wp);
793         HDAC_WRITE_2(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BRP, HDAC_CORBRP_CORBRPRST);
794         /*
795          * The HDA specification indicates that the CORBRPRST bit will always
796          * read as zero. Unfortunately, it seems that at least the 82801G
797          * doesn't reset the bit to zero, which stalls the corb engine.
798          * manually reset the bit to zero before continuing.
799          */
800         HDAC_WRITE_2(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BRP, 0x0);
801
802         /* Enable CORB error reporting */
803 #if 0
804         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_CORBCTL, HDAC_CORBCTL_CMEIE);
805 #endif
806 }
807
808 /****************************************************************************
809  * void hdac_rirb_init(struct hdac_softc *)
810  *
811  * Initialize the rirb registers for operations but do not start it up yet.
812  * The RIRB engine must not be running when this function is called.
813  ****************************************************************************/
814 static void
815 hdac_rirb_init(struct hdac_softc *sc)
816 {
817         uint8_t rirbsize;
818         uint64_t rirbpaddr;
819
820         /* Setup the RIRB size. */
821         switch (sc->rirb_size) {
822         case 256:
823                 rirbsize = HDAC_RIRBSIZE_RIRBSIZE(HDAC_RIRBSIZE_RIRBSIZE_256);
824                 break;
825         case 16:
826                 rirbsize = HDAC_RIRBSIZE_RIRBSIZE(HDAC_RIRBSIZE_RIRBSIZE_16);
827                 break;
828         case 2:
829                 rirbsize = HDAC_RIRBSIZE_RIRBSIZE(HDAC_RIRBSIZE_RIRBSIZE_2);
830                 break;
831         default:
832                 panic("%s: Invalid RIRB size (%x)\n", __func__, sc->rirb_size);
833         }
834         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BSIZE, rirbsize);
835
836         /* Setup the RIRB Address in the hdac */
837         rirbpaddr = (uint64_t)sc->rirb_dma.dma_paddr;
838         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BLBASE, (uint32_t)rirbpaddr);
839         HDAC_WRITE_4(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BUBASE, (uint32_t)(rirbpaddr >> 32));
840
841         /* Setup the WP and RP */
842         sc->rirb_rp = 0;
843         HDAC_WRITE_2(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BWP, HDAC_RIRBWP_RIRBWPRST);
844
845         /* Setup the interrupt threshold */
846         HDAC_WRITE_2(&sc->mem, HDAC_RINTCNT, sc->rirb_size / 2);
847
848         /* Enable Overrun and response received reporting */
849 #if 0
850         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BCTL,
851             HDAC_RIRBCTL_RIRBOIC | HDAC_RIRBCTL_RINTCTL);
852 #else
853         HDAC_WRITE_1(&sc->mem, HDAC_RIRBCTL, HDAC_RIRBCTL_RINTCTL);
854 #endif
855
856         /*
857          * Make sure that the Host CPU cache doesn't contain any dirty
858          * cache lines that falls in the rirb. If I understood correctly, it
859          * should be sufficient to do this only once as the rirb is purely
860          * read-only from now on.
861          */
862         bus_dmamap_sync(sc->rirb_dma.dma_tag, sc->rirb_dma.dma_map,
863             BUS_DMASYNC_PREREAD);
864 }
